Nearly one million Sri Lankans register with TIN

Colombo, Jan 4 (Daily Mirror) - The number of individuals registering with the Taxpayer Identification Number (TIN) in Sri Lanka has reached nearly 01 million, according to the Inland Revenue Department.

Previously, in the fiscal year 2022, there were only 204,467 personal tax files. 

However, the latest data indicates a remarkable surge, with the number now approaching the one-million mark. 

Moreover, the Department reported a notable uptick in the number of tax-paying companies. 

This year has witnessed a commendable 10 percent increase, with the count rising from 73,444 registered tax-paying companies in 2022 to a current total of 81,909 as of November 30.
